Launchpad Janitor (janitor) wrote :

This bug was fixed in the package ubuntuone-client - 1.0.0-0ubuntu1

---------------
ubuntuone-client (1.0.0-0ubuntu1) karmic; urgency=low

  * New upstream release.
    - Limit log messages, file size, and rotate more often (LP: #435137)
    - Rotate oauth-login.log and cap the file size (LP: #445514)
    - Remove pycurl usage in favor of urllib and better errors (LP: #411029)
    - Save the syncdaemon settings for bw limiting (LP: #418882)
    - Fix NoSuchDatabase when pairing desktopcouch (LP: #438411)
    - Fix IOError when launching preferences window (LP: #441039)
    - Update icons to remove Ubuntu logo, better names (LP: #434886)
    - Use ngettext for the possibly singular notification (LP: #449269)
    - Only create Places bookmark when first authorizing (LP: #397749)
    - Don't always recreate the bookmark (LP: #401211)
    - Handle showing emblems better (LP: #440839)
    - Remove the System->Preferences menu item (LP: #443342)
    - Remove NotOnlineError usage (LP: #404550)
    - Set a default share name in the Nautilus sharing UI (LP: #369488)
    - Simplify some state handling (LP: #420354)

 -- Rodney Dawes <email address hidden> Mon, 28 Sep 2009 18:15:00 -0400

dobey (dobey) wrote :

Hi Tom, I think you are experiencing a different issue, for which the
fix is currently in proposed updates for Karmic, and should make it to
the updates archive soon.

The issue in this bug was that the preferences app
(ubuntuone-client-preferences) was having an issue starting up, when the
config directory or file didn't already exist. And this specific issue
has been fixed.

If you want to file a new bug, using the "Report a Problem" menu item on
the applet, or by running "ubuntu-bug ubuntuone-client" we can look at
your issue individually and determine if it's a new issue or if it's a
dup of an already existing issue.

Thanks.
